Summary: Something was missing . . .
Comment: I had a hard time believing that this was the same author who had crafted my beloved Sally Lockhart and His Dark Materials trilogies. Description - too much description. And no characterization whatsoever. Becky was a weak character and I couldn't relate to her at all. And the fact that a London "fancy lady" could become the Queen of a small German/Austrian duchy was too unrealistic for me. (Yes, I know that miracles *can* happen, but this one was too far out there.) The only reason I stuck around was to see if Sally would appear again in the end, as she did.

I was also very dissappionted with the ending. Adelaide wanted Sally's approval so much - in the end, couldn't Pullman have just included Sally telling her that no one could have done better than she did? That was the biggest hole, was that we never saw Sally praise Adelaide at last, which seemed really out of character for her.

I suppose you should read this if you're looking for a quick (but drab) read, but my advice would be that if you don't want to spoil the spell that the Sally Lockhart trilogy cast on you, then don't.

Summary: it was good
Comment: Actually it's been awhile since I read this book but I remember it to be a pretty good book. It was adventuresome and fun. It was also nice to see the Sally Lockhart trilogy characters again. Sure some of the events were a little too convenient but I love Philip Pullman as an authur enough to forgive him. I really love the Victorian setting although this book is a little different being in Germany in all. My main purpose for writing this review though is to point out that this book is NOT part of the Sally Lockhart Trilogy as some people have said! It was in fact a follow up. The third book is "Tiger in the Well" which does tell us of Sally's new husband and the circumstances that brought them together. It was an excellent book and you should go back and read the Lockhart trilogy in order before reading this book!

Summary: A Complete and Utter Letdown -- Deserves Zero Stars
Comment: It is difficult for me to believe that the author who wrote such wonderfully rich books as "The Ropemaker" and the "His Dark Materials" trilogy could write such drivel as "The Tin Princess." Pullman's artistic ability is apparent in his descriptions of political intrigues and cunning plots, but these wonderful descriptions are sadly hidden by the boring, monotonous, one-dimensional characters. Adelaide's coldness, selfishness, and almost shrewish behavior makes it impossible to believe that she could be so beloved by everyone in this novel. Becky, the one character in the book that could have had potential, is shunted to the side and allowed only to play the part of the eager sidekick whose only purpose is to serve the main character.

People who are interested in Pullman's works would do better to read his fantastical novels and leave his clumsy attempts at 'reality' fiction on the shelf.
